Why Proper Storage Matters
Nut butters are natural products made from ground nuts, often with no preservatives. This means they can be sensitive to heat, light, and air, which can affect their flavor and quality over time. Similarly, Stuffed Oat Bars contain ingredients like oats and nut butter that can become stale or lose their crunch if not stored correctly.
Understanding the factors that affect freshness—such as temperature, exposure to air, and moisture—can help you extend the shelf life of your products. By following a few simple storage rules, you can maintain the delicious taste and texture you love.
- Keep nut butter away from direct sunlight and heat sources.
- Always seal the container tightly after each use to minimize air exposure.
How to Store Nut Butter Jars
Most natural nut butters, like our Peanut Butter and Almond Butter, are best stored in a cool, dry place, such as a pantry or cupboard. The ideal temperature is between 60-70°F (15-21°C). Avoid storing them near the stove or in direct sunlight, as heat can accelerate oil separation and spoilage.
If you live in a warm climate or prefer a firmer texture, you can refrigerate your nut butter. Refrigeration can significantly extend the shelf life, especially for varieties without added preservatives. Just remember that refrigerated nut butter may become harder and less spreadable, so you might need to let it sit at room temperature for a few minutes before use.
- Use a clean, dry spoon every time you scoop to prevent introducing moisture or bacteria.
- If oil separation occurs, simply stir the nut butter thoroughly before each use.
Storing Stuffed Oat Bars for Maximum Freshness
Our Stuffed Oat Bars are perfect for on-the-go snacking, but they need proper storage to stay fresh and chewy. The best way to store them is in an airtight container at room temperature, away from heat and humidity. This helps preserve their texture and prevents them from becoming stale or hard.
If you don't plan to eat them within a week, you can freeze the bars. Wrap each bar individually in plastic wrap or foil, then place them in a freezer-safe bag. They can be stored in the freezer for up to three months. When you're ready to enjoy one, simply thaw it at room temperature or pop it in the microwave for a few seconds.
- Keep the bars in their original packaging if unopened, as it's designed to maintain freshness.
- For longer storage, freeze the bars and thaw as needed.
Common Storage Mistakes to Avoid
One common mistake is leaving nut butter jars open or not sealing them properly. Exposure to air can cause the oils to oxidize, leading to off-flavors. Another mistake is storing nut butter in the refrigerator door, where the temperature fluctuates. Instead, place it on a shelf in the main compartment.
For oat bars, avoid storing them in warm areas like a car or near a window, as heat can melt the chocolate or cause the bars to become sticky. Also, don't store them in the fridge, as the moisture can make them soggy. Stick to cool, dry places for optimal freshness.
- Always check the 'best before' date and consume within a reasonable time after opening.
- If you notice any off smell or mold, discard the product immediately.
